The Role

Silicon Labs is building a world-class Software Centre of Excellence in Hyderabad, and we are looking for an experienced Software Quality Assurance (SQA) Manager to build and lead our IEEE 802.15.4, Zigbee, and OpenThread QA team.

This team will be responsible for driving the quality of software and firmware for Silicon Labs EFR wireless SoCs, with primary focus on IEEE 802.15.4-based connectivity solutions, including Zigbee and Thread/OpenThread. The team will also validate relevant end-to-end ecosystems such as Matter over Thread and interoperability with devices, controllers, border routers, and third-party implementations.

The manager will combine strong people leadership with sufficient technical depth to guide validation strategy, quality engineering, automation, interoperability, and release readiness for low-power mesh networking products used across smart home, industrial, commercial, and other IoT markets.

This position is based out of Silicon Labs, Hyderabad. The role requires close collaboration with global teams across the USA and Europe and therefore requires flexibility in work hours to accommodate meetings and stakeholder engagement later in the day.

What You Will Do

- Lead, build, and manage a high-performing SQA team in Hyderabad focused on IEEE 802.15.4, Zigbee, and Thread/OpenThread technologies.
- Own people management responsibilities including hiring, onboarding, resource planning, mentoring, performance management, career development, and retention of a highly skilled QA organization.
- Drive validation strategy and execution for Silicon Labs EFR-based IEEE 802.15.4 solutions, with deep focus on Zigbee and OpenThread/Thread and relevant Matter over Thread use cases.
- Ensure comprehensive quality coverage across protocol functionality, network formation and operation, security, interoperability, system integration, negative and stress scenarios, performance, reliability, and regression testing.
- Guide validation of representative Zigbee behaviors and ecosystems, including commissioning/network formation, routing and mesh behavior, application-layer interactions, security, interoperability, and long-duration network stability.
- Guide validation of Thread/OpenThread networking, including commissioning/attachment, mesh formation and routing, IPv6/6LoWPAN behavior, security, border-router interactions, interoperability, and network robustness.
- Partner closely with protocol-stack development, firmware, embedded software, applications, program management, product teams, and global engineering organizations to align priorities, schedules, defect resolution, and release readiness.
- Establish measurable quality processes and metrics covering test effectiveness, automation, defect trends, regressions, release risk, and execution predictability.
- Drive scalable automation for protocol and system validation,



reduce legacy/manual test backlog, and steer automation architecture toward reusable, maintainable frameworks and lab infrastructure.
- Drive interoperability and ecosystem validation with third-party devices and implementations, and support readiness for relevant Zigbee, Thread, and Matter certification activities.
- Regularly communicate project status, quality metrics, risks, trade-offs, and mitigation plans to local and global leadership.
- Champion continuous improvement in QA methodologies, tools, infrastructure, engineering productivity, and team effectiveness.
- Drive adoption of modern engineering productivity practices, including responsible use of Gen AI-assisted development and QA tools, to improve automation velocity, debugging efficiency, and engineering effectiveness.

What We Are Looking For

- Proven experience building and managing software quality assurance, software development in test, or embedded wireless validation teams, preferably in the semiconductor or wireless connectivity domain.
- Strong technical understanding of IEEE 802.15.4 and hands-on experience testing, validating, debugging, or developing Zigbee and/or Thread/OpenThread solutions. Strong candidates should have depth in at least one of Zigbee or OpenThread and meaningful working knowledge of the other.
- Solid understanding of low-power mesh networking concepts, including network formation, addressing, routing, security, commissioning, interoperability, and behavior under scale, interference, and long-duration operation.
- Working knowledge of Zigbee architecture and ecosystem concepts such as Zigbee application profiles/device behavior, Zigbee Cluster Library (ZCL), commissioning, security, and mesh networking.
- Working knowledge of Thread/OpenThread architecture and ecosystem concepts such as IPv6, 6LoWPAN, mesh routing, device roles, commissioning, security, and Thread Border Router interactions.
- Experience validating embedded software and firmware on MCU- and wireless SoC-based systems, including system-level debugging across host, stack, radio, and application boundaries.
- Experience with interoperability, certification-oriented validation, or ecosystem testing involving multiple vendors/devices.
- Strong understanding of data communications and networking concepts and the ability to translate protocol requirements and customer use cases into effective validation strategies.
- Experience working closely with cross-functional global teams including development,



program management, product, and field/application engineering, with the ability to work flexibly across time zones supporting teams in the USA and Europe.
- Solid track record of driving execution, prioritizing across concurrent deliverables, resolving project risks, and delivering to schedule commitments.
- Experience with CI/CD workflows, automated regression systems, test infrastructure, and quality practices.
- Proficiency in Python for test automation and debugging; working knowledge of C/C++ and embedded debugging is strongly preferred.
- Strong working knowledge of Git and issue/project tracking tools such as Jira.
- Strong communication, stakeholder management, and leadership skills, with a creative, pragmatic, hands-on, and problem-solving leadership style.

Experience Required

- 12+ years of overall experience in embedded software, wireless connectivity, networking, or related engineering fields, with substantial experience in IEEE 802.15.4-based technologies.
- 2+ years of experience directly managing an engineering/SQA team of approximately 5–8 members, including hiring, performance management, mentoring, resource planning, and delivery ownership.
- Demonstrated ownership of quality or engineering deliverables for production software/firmware releases.
- Ability to operate independently, make sound technical and execution trade-offs, and drive results with minimal supervision.

Preferred Qualifications

- Experience with Silicon Labs EFR platforms, Simplicity Studio, Gecko SDK, or comparable wireless SoC platforms and SDKs.
- Deep experience in either Zigbee or Thread/OpenThread protocol-stack validation or development, with practical exposure to the other technology.
- Experience with Zigbee certification/interoperability programs, Thread certification, Matter certification, or related ecosystem test events.
- Experience validating Matter over Thread, including interactions among end devices, commissioners/controllers, and Thread Border Routers.
- Experience with protocol analyzers and packet sniffers such as Wireshark and IEEE 802.15.4 capture/debug tools, as well as embedded development/debug environments.
- Experience designing scalable automated test beds, RF/network test infrastructure, device farms, and long-duration or large-network validation environments.
- Familiarity with coexistence considerations involving IEEE 802.15.4 and other 2.4 GHz radios such as Bluetooth LE or Wi-Fi.
- Demonstrated experience applying Generative AI tools such as GitHub Copilot, Cursor, or similar platforms to an engineering productivity or quality initiative.

Education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Electronics/Communication Engineering, Computer Science, or a related discipline preferred; equivalent relevant education and experience will also be considered.
